Tennessee won the last time they faced West Ridge and things went their way on Friday too. The Tennessee Vikings slipped by the West Ridge Wolves 64-63. The victory made it back-to-back wins for the Vikings.

Tennessee's win was the result of several impressive offensive performances. One of the most notable came from Colin Brown, who went 9 of 16 on his way to 21 points and six assists. The matchup was Brown's 11th in a row with at least ten points. The team also got some help courtesy of Zander Phillips, who went 5 of 12 on his way to 16 points.
Tennessee's victory bumped their record up to 9-2. As for West Ridge, they have traveled a rocky road recently having lost three of their last four contests, which put a noticeable dent in their 7-3 record this season.
